History of Blue Pigments
Traditionally, blue was Just about the most valuable pigments. Lapis lazuli, ground into ultramarine, was imported from Afghanistan at great Price tag. This rarity built blue a coloration of Status in Renaissance art. Later, Prussian blue and synthetic ultramarine expanded its use and democratized the colour for artists everywhere you go.
Blue in Modern-day and Up to date Art
Modern artists like Pablo Picasso famously made use of a “Blue Interval” to specific melancholy and introspection. Abstract artists use blue expanses to propose emotion with no sort. In present-day painting, blue can be Daring, graphic, small, or layered in delicate gradients to explore light-weight, temper, and texture.
